Overall Meaning

The lyrics of Adam Hambrick's song "Looking Out For Me" are about the ups and downs of life and how sometimes, we don't get what we deserve. The first verse talks about the concept of karma and how mistakes we make in the past can come back to haunt us. The singer then questions why he sometimes gets good things even when he doesn't deserve them - "Why when I deserve thunder, would I get to see the sunshine?" The chorus continues with this theme of life's unpredictability and how we often end up where we're supposed to be even if we stumble down the wrong roads.


The second verse shifts focus to the concept of love and how it works in mysterious ways. The singer notes that sometimes, love just happens and it's not something we can control or name. The chorus repeats, once again questioning why good things happen to us even when we don't deserve them, and ends with the realization that maybe we're not alone in looking out for ourselves.


Overall, "Looking Out For Me" is a song about acceptance and finding comfort in life's uncertainties. It reminds us that sometimes, things just happen and we have to trust that we're on the right path even if we don't understand why.
